git更换分支
-
要更换Git分支,可以使用以下命令:
1. 查看当前所在分支:`git branch`
2. 切换到目标分支:`git checkout`
3. 这样就成功切换到了目标分支。另外,如果需要创建新的分支并切换到该分支,可以使用以下命令:
1. 创建新分支:`git branch
`
2. 切换到新创建的分支:`git checkout` 如果想要切换分支但不希望现有的改动丢失,可以使用以下命令:
1. 提交当前分支的改动:`git commit -am “Save changes”`
2. 切换到目标分支:`git checkout`
3. 在切换至目标分支后,可以使用以下命令将之前的改动应用到目标分支:`git cherry-pick` 另外,如果要将本地分支切换到远程分支,可以使用以下命令:
1. 首先,确保本地与远程仓库同步:`git fetch`
2. 然后,切换到远程分支:`git checkout -borigin/ ` 需要注意的是,切换分支可能会导致未提交的改动丢失,所以在切换分支前最好先进行提交或者保存改动。同时,切换分支后需要重新构建项目或者进行相应的操作。
2年前 -
要更换Git分支,请按照以下步骤进行操作:
1. 查看现有分支:使用`git branch`命令可以查看当前仓库中存在的所有本地分支。当前分支前会有一个`*`符号。
2. 创建新分支(可选):如果你需要创建一个新分支来切换到,可以使用`git branch
`命令创建一个新分支。例如:`git branch newbranch`。 3. 切换到其他分支:使用`git checkout
`命令可以切换到指定的分支。例如:`git checkout otherbranch`。 4. 切换到已有分支:如果你已经在本地创建了一个分支,可以直接使用`git checkout
`命令切换到已有的分支。 5. 切换到远程分支:如果需要切换到远程仓库中的分支,可以使用`git checkout -b
origin/ `命令创建并切换到该远程分支。例如:`git checkout -b newbranch origin/newbranch`。 需要注意的是,在切换分支之前,确保你已经提交并推送了当前分支的所有更改,以免丢失工作。
以下是一些其他常用的Git分支操作命令:
– `git branch -d
`:删除本地分支。
– `git push origin –delete`:删除远程分支。
– `git merge`:将指定分支的更改合并到当前分支。
– `git rebase`:将当前分支的更改应用到指定分支上。 记住,在切换分支之前,一定要明确你当前工作的状态,并确保你已经保存、提交和推送了所有重要的更改。
2年前 -
更换分支是在Git中常见的操作之一,它允许我们在开发过程中切换不同的分支,以便进行不同的工作。下面是更换分支的方法和操作流程。
1. 查看当前分支
在进行分支切换之前,首先要查看当前所处的分支。可以使用以下命令查看:
“`
$ git branch
“`该命令将列出所有本地分支,并在当前分支前添加一个星号(*)。
2. 创建新分支(可选)
如果需要创建一个新的分支,可以使用以下命令:
“`
$ git branch
“`其中,`
`是新分支的名称。创建分支后,我们仍然停留在当前分支。 3. 切换分支
要切换分支,可以使用以下命令:
“`
$ git checkout
“`其中,`
`是要切换到的分支的名称。切换分支后,我们将在目标分支上进行操作。 4. 拉取远程分支(可选)
如果要切换到远程仓库中的分支,可以使用以下命令:
“`
$ git checkout -borigin/
“`其中,`
`是要创建的本地分支的名称,` `是要切换到的远程分支的名称。 5. 删除本地分支(可选)
如果需要删除本地分支,可以使用以下命令:
“`
$ git branch -d
“`其中,`
`是要删除的分支的名称。删除分支时,要确保当前不在要删除的分支上。 6. 合并分支(可选)
在切换分支后,如果需要将其他分支的更改合并到当前分支中,可以使用以下命令:
“`
$ git merge
“`其中,`
`是要合并的分支的名称。合并分支时,要确保我们在目标分支上。 7. 更新和推送分支(可选)
如果在切换分支之前已经在当前分支上进行了一些更改,并且希望将这些更改推送到远程仓库或者更新远程分支,可以使用以下命令:
“`
$ git push origin
“`其中,`
`是要推送或更新的分支的名称。 以上是在Git中更换分支的方法和操作流程。根据实际需求,选择适当的步骤来完成分支切换和相关操作。在切换分支时,要谨慎处理未提交的更改,以免数据丢失或冲突发生。
2年前